我是JUnit和Mock的新手。这是实际工作,但我注意到在使用Map<String, Object>的测试中接收空值,原因是,如果它们是条件,则不能为空。总有一天我会需要这个。
我所做的是因为Map<String, Object>不能在headers.setAll()中实现,因为它需要Map<String, String>,所以我转换它。
@RestController
public class TestController {
@GetMapping("/test")
public String testAuth(
我正在Java程序中使用XSL进行XML转换。这是示例XML
<root>
<head>Heading goes here</head>
<middle>Some text goes here</middle>
<body>Body goes here ’ with special characters</body>
</root>
XSL有标识模板,它只是删除了一个<middle>元素。
<?xml version="1.0"?>
我有一个.Net/C# Web API 2.0 REST服务,如果用Postman测试,它工作得很好,但如果用Post从Angular2/4http服务调用,总是得到null参数。
代码如下:
C#:
public class UsersController : ApiController
{
// POST: api/users/login
public string login([FromBody]string value)
{
var ss = value;
return value;
}
}
Angular2服务:
lo